NO CASUALTIES REPORTED AFTER ARMOURY FIRE AT GIWA BARRACKS; EXCESSIVE HEAT SUSPECTED                                                                                 01-05-25

By Sadiq Aminu                                                        Borno State Deputy Governor, Alhaji Umar Usman Kadafur, has paid an assessment visit to Giwa Barracks Maiduguri to assess the aftermath of a heavy explosion and fire that occurred at the facility’s armoury last night.

The General Officer Commanding (GOC) 7 Division, Major General A.G.L. Haruna, who received the deputy Governor, confirmed that there were no casualties resulting from the incident. However, he disclosed that a significant quantity of explosives and ammunition had been destroyed in the fire.

According to Major General Haruna, preliminary investigations suggest that the fire was triggered by excessive heat resulting from the extremely high temperatures currently being experienced in the state.

The GOC conducted Deputy Governor Kadafur around the affected areas, providing a firsthand assessment of the damage.

Deputy Governor Kadafur commended the swift response of the military in containing the situation and assured the public that the government is closely monitoring developments to ensure the continued safety and security of residents.

The incident at Giwa Barracks, a major military installation in Maiduguri, had caused considerable alarm among residents due to the multiple explosions. The barracks serves as both a base of operations for counter-insurgency efforts and a detention facility for suspected Boko Haram members. While the fire is now under control, investigations are ongoing to determine the full extent of the damage and implement preventative measures.
